Basic Soil Analysis
General soil fertility suite covering key nutrients and pH.
Measures: pH, Olsen P, Ca, Mg, K, Na, Bulk Density, CEC, Base Saturation
When to test: Before planting a crop/new pasture or at the same time each year for monitoring.
Pasture Soil Analysis
The recommended soil fertility suite for nutrient budget analysis
Measures: pH, Olsen P, Ca, Mg, K, Na, Bulk Density, CEC, Base Saturation + SO4-S + Organic S
When to test: Late winter-early spring when sulphur levels are most representative and before peak pasture growth.
Cropping Soil Analysis
Helps match fertiliser inputs to crop demand, improve nitrogen use efficiency, and optimise yield potential.
Measures: pH, Olsen P, Ca, Mg, K, Na, Bulk Density, CEC, Base Saturation + SO4-S + Organic S + Anaerobic Mineralisable N
When to test: Before planting or early in the season to guide nutrient planning.

Mineral N (Deep Nitrogen Test) Analysis
Mineral N Analysis for immediately available Nitrogen
Measures: Ammoniacal-N and Nitrate-N
When to test: Pre-plant and/or just before side dress N is applied.
Potentially Mineralisable Nitrogen (PMN)
Smart Sustainability through PMN Testing! Cost-Efficiency for Nitrogen Management
Measures: Nitrogen potentially released from organic matter over a period of time during crop growth
When to test: On cropping soils before planting.
Anion Storage Capacity (P Retention)
Find out how well your soil holds key nutrients like phosphorus and sulphur.
Measures: Measures the ability of the soil to store anions like phosphate and sulphate.
When to test: Initial test to establish value for soil type.
Reserve Potassium (TBK)
Tap into the ability of some soils to release potassium over time
Measures: Potassium captured within the clay structures of the soil that is not extracted by the conventional quick soil test. It is the fraction of potassium that is slower to become plant available
When to test: As an extra test during routine soil testing on sedimentary and recent soils.
Anaerobically Mineralisable Nitrogen (AMN)
Provides insights into soil nitrogen availability
Measures: Potentially available nitrogen through anaerobic soil incubation
When to test: Pre-plant.
Organic Matter
Monitor carbon sequestration
Measures: Organic matter content is calculated by multiplying total carbon by 1.72
When to test: As an extra test during routine soil testing.
Exchangeable Aluminium
Confirm aluminium toxicity that can negatively affect plant growth
Measures: Aluminium extractable with an dilute calcium chloride solution
When to test: Only when the pH is below 5.5

Clover / Brassica / Legume Analysis
Records levels of essential plant nutrients including Molybdenum in the plant. When correlated with typical nutrient levels at a specific growth stage it is used to identify how accessible nutrients are to the plant.
Measures: N, P, K, S, Ca, Mg, Na, Fe, Mn, Cu, Zn, B, Mo
When to test: During the growing season to ensure sufficiency of Mo.
Comprehensive Pasture Analysis
Comprehensive Analysis. Fuelling ryegrass and clover for thriving performance. Clover is the main source of nitrogen for pasture growth, and it usually shows mineral shortages before the grass does - giving an early warning of issues.
Measures: N, P, K, S, Ca, Mg, Na, Fe, Mn, Cu, Zn, B, Co, Se + Mo on whole samples.
N, P, K, S, Ca, Mg, Na, Fe, Mn, Cu, Zn, B + Mo on clover only samples.
When to test: During the growing season when climate is not limiting pasture growth, often during late Spring.

Urgent Nitrate-Nitrogen Analysis – for animal toxicity
Nitrate are natural in plants, but if they are not converted to proteins they can build up in the plant and at high levels can be toxic to livestock. Results are the same day for samples received in the morning.
Measures: NO3-N
When to test: After a period of cool or overcast weather (e.g. frosts) drought stress - basically things that affect plant growth rates.
